Product Description

Baileigh variable speed bench top lathe was developed from the MLD-1030. The lathe features adjustable RPM from 50-2000 and includes a digital read out for accurate cutting speed. A powerful 110 volts 1 hp motor that allows you to operate anywhere there is a standard outlet. Steady rest, follow rest, three jaw chuck, and four jaw chuck are just a few of the options that come standard on this bench top lathe. Chuck diameter: 4.92-inches; tool slide travel: 1.89-inches; spindle accuracy: 0.001-inches; range of metric threads: 0.4 - 3.4 millimeters; spindle bore: 1-inch; range of inch threads: 8 - 56 TPI; taper of tailstock quill: MT 2; swing over bed: 9-3/4-inches; distance between centers: 22-inches.
